This position is a fixed term appointment for a period of two years (24 months) to contribute to research in artificial intelligence, with a particular focus on large language models and their applications. Applications are particularly invited from researchers who undertake high-impact collaborative and cross-disciplinary research, and whose interests and expertise contribute to the activity cluster, School, and College.
In-depth knowledge in at least one of the following areas will be highly regarded: the technology of large language models, natural language and text processing, qualitative and quantitative methods for evaluating system and user behaviour.
Join a growing portfolio of projects in artificial intelligence, natural language processing, and machine learning. These projects build on the School's strengths in AI, machine learning and vision, natural language understanding and robotics. They also collaborate with other requisite disciplines to integrate human and social values in AI systems, touching on aspects of philosophy, cognition, policy, and safety.
You will conduct research on Human-Centred AI with applications in bridging the information gaps in real world applications and design and implement novel algorithms, formulating and solving human-centered AI problems. The Research Fellow will also support the development of partnerships with industry and government stakeholders, engage with the wider research community to advance computing research and education capabilities.
In addition, you will contribute to the School educational programs, including being the mentor for research students and teaching activities that align with your career development. The nature and scope of these activities will be negotiated between the Research Fellow, their supervisor, and the school.
The School of Computing has a strong foundation in computing and information sciences at ANU. We are a transformative centre for research in artificial intelligence and machine learning, computer systems and software, and theoretical foundations of computing. We span traditional and modern thinking, connecting decades of computer science methodologies with modern data and computational science. Our mission is motivated by the need to design, drive and sustain strategic activities via five broad focus areas: Computing Foundations, Computational Science, Intelligent Systems, Data Science and Analytics, and the Software Innovation Institute.
